TikTok has become a fantastic platform for content creators, brands, and businesses alike. Every day, countless videos go viral, and many people are eager to learn how to produce content that others enjoy, like, and share. That's where Artificial Intelligence (AI) can be a real game-changer. AI tools can help generate video ideas, catchy captions, compelling hooks, scripts, and trending topics. However, here's a key tip: how you prompt AI significantly affects the quality of its suggestions. A prompt is simply the instruction you give to an AI tool. Asking the right questions can lead to creative ideas that make your TikTok content stand out. So, here are five straightforward tips to help you craft better prompts for AI and create viral content.

1. Be Clear About Your Niche
When using AI, one common mistake is asking very broad questions. TikTok works best when your content focuses on a specific niche. Instead of saying: “Give me TikTok ideas,” try something more detailed like: “Give me 10 TikTok video ideas for a small African food business aiming to attract new customers.” This helps AI understand your specific content area and target audience. When AI knows your niche, the ideas it provides will be more relevant and helpful. Always tell AI what your content is about, who your audience is, and what results you're seeking. This simple step can make a significant difference.

2. Ask AI for Strong Hooks
On TikTok, the first three seconds are crucial. If your hook is dull, viewers might just scroll past. A hook is the opening line or moment that captures attention. Instead of asking for an entire script at once, try prompting like this: “Give me 15 catchy TikTok hooks for a street food video in Lagos,” or “Write 10 viral TikTok hooks that will make viewers stop scrolling.” AI is excellent at creating hooks like: “You won’t believe how this food is made,” “I tried the most underrated street food in Lagos,” or “This mistake is costing your food business customers.” Great hooks can really boost your chances of keeping viewers engaged.


3. Ask for short video scripts
Many creators find it helpful to ask AI for short, lively scripts that match their style. Instead of just saying, “Write a TikTok script,” try giving more details, like, “Write a 30-second TikTok script for a food brand showcasing how their special jollof rice is made, with a fun and engaging tone.” You can also specify styles such as storytelling, funny, educational, or relatable content to match your vibe. Short, clear, and lively scripts make filming much easier.

4. Ask AI to turn trends into fresh ideas Whether it’s sounds, challenges, or storytelling formats, AI can help brainstorm ideas like “Expectation vs Reality” or “Day in the life of a small business owner,” keeping your content fresh and relatable.

5. Ask for captions and hashtags
They’re key to reaching more viewers! You can ask AI to craft engaging captions or suggest hashtags—for example, “Give me 5 captions for a video showing African dishes” or “Suggest hashtags for a Nigerian food creator.” Captions that ask questions, make relatable statements, or include a call to action—like “Would you try this?” or “Tag someone who loves jollof rice”—can really boost your engagement.
